If you think the choices from Inverness are lacking, you couldn't be more mistaken... most travellers still aren’t aware that destinations such as New York, Thailand, Sri Lanka, Miami, South Africa, the Caribbean, Dubai and many other global destinations are easily accessible from Inverness airport.
Also, you may not have known that once you are check-in in Inverness, your baggage is checked through to your final destination, meaning at your next airport, you can sit back with a coffee or glass of wine, and relax knowing that none of the hustle & bustle applies to you.
Scheduled flights operate between Inverness and the local airports of Stornoway in the Western Isles, Kirkwall in Orkney and Sumburgh in Shetland as well as between other UK airports, including London Gatwick, London Heathrow, London Luton, Belfast City, Birmingham, Bristol, Jersey and Manchester.
There are also direct scheduled flights to other European airports, including Amsterdam, and Dublin, plus seasonal flights to Geneva, Zurich, and Mallorca.
Meanwhile, the hub airports of Schiphol Amsterdam, Dublin or London Heathrow offer many opportunities for onward connecting flights – opening up a whole world of travel experiences!
